History

Founded in 1992, Bend Studio (formerly Blank, Berlyn & Co. and Eidetic) are an Oregon-based developer Sony acquired in 2000. While they're best known for the Syphon Filter shooter series on PS1, PS2, and PSP, they've also developed spin-off games from IP created at other first-party studios, like Uncharted: Golden Abyss (Naughty Dog) and Resistance: Retribution (Insomniac).

Bend's most recent game is 2019's action-adventure Days Gone on PS4, which got remastered on PS5 in April 2025. This native PS5 re-release includes resolution and framerate upgrades, a new horde mode, and other smaller additions like a PS5 trophy list.

My Analysis & Predictions

Despite DG shipping over 6 years ago, we don't even have a name for Bend's next game due to a very long string of bad luck and incompetence:

  • Bend pitched Days Gone 2, which Sony rejected due to DG's initial reception.
  • A 2020 internal power struggle resulted in DG's writer and creative director leaving.
  • Bend's new leadership then greenlit a live-service game based on an original IP.
  • That game was then cancelled in January 2025, likely due to Sony's colder feet for internal live services, post-Concord.

Fortunately, much of DG's criticism comes from those who lost the power struggle. Between that, Sony's increased reluctance in live services, DG getting a remaster, and the more positive general consensus around the IP in 2026, there's a better chance DG2 is greenlit than in recent years, which is the best-case scenario.

The worst-case scenario is Bend's closure, which is more likely given they've shipped 1 game in 15 years that came with a lot of controversy. They're also years away from shipping a second. At the very least, don't expect a new Bend title until PS6, making the PS5 a truly wasted generation for them due to former leadership and Sony's poor live service execution.
